2022 Susan Smith Blackburn Prize Awarded to Benedict Lombe for LAVA
by Chloe Rabinowitz - Apr 11, 2022


The 2022 Susan Smith Blackburn Prize has been awarded to U.K. playwright Benedict Lombe for her debut play Lava. In a special presentation at Shakespeare's Globe in London, the Blackburn Prize judges presented Lombe with a cash prize of $25,000, and a signed limited-edition print by renowned artist Willem de Kooning, created especially for the Prize. 

Full Cast Announced For OUR COUNTRY'S GOOD At South Pasadena Theatre Workshop
by A.A. Cristi - Apr 7, 2022


The South Pasadena Theatre Workshop has announced the cast for a new production of Timberlake Wertenbaker's award-winning dark comedy, Our Country's Good. Set in newly colonized Australia in the late 18th century, the production will run from May 26 to June 26. SPTW Artistic Director and co-founder, Sally Godwin Smythe, will direct the cast of twelve. 

Jermyn Street Theatre Announces Winner Of Woven Voices Prize For Playwriting
by Stephi Wild - Apr 5, 2022


Today, Jermyn Street Theatre has announced the winners of two major initiatives promoting underrepresented theatremakers: the Woven Voices Prize for Playwriting in collaboration with Woven Voices, and the 2022 cohort of Creative Associates. The winner of the first Woven Voices Prize, dedicated to celebrating and platforming migrant playwrights, is Kazakhstan-born  Karina Wiedman (video here) with her play The Anarchist.
